What is Oxycodone?

Oxycodone has active ingredients of oxycodone hydrochloride. It is often used in pain. eHealthMe is studying from 162,592 Oxycodone users. Check the latest studies of Oxycodone.

What is Levonorgestrel and ethinyl estradiol?

Levonorgestrel and ethinyl estradiol has active ingredients of ethinyl estradiol; levonorgestrel. It is often used in birth control. eHealthMe is studying from 768 Levonorgestrel and ethinyl estradiol users. Check the latest studies of Levonorgestrel and ethinyl estradiol.
